Case brief

RBI has imposed a monetary penalty of ₹1.50 lakh on The Karaikudi Co-operative Town Bank Limited, Tamil Nadu. The action follows non-compliance with prudential capital adequacy and KYC directions.

Impact

The bank must absorb the monetary penalty and remain compliant with RBI’s prudential capital adequacy and KYC directions going forward. The release also makes clear that the penalty does not preclude any other action RBI may initiate later.

Why RBI acted

Capital & exposure normsKYC / AMLLending norms

Regulatory basis

  • Section 47A(1)(c) read with Sections 46(4)(i) and 56 of the Banking Regulation Act, 1949

Case brief

RBI imposed a ₹50,000 penalty on The Karaikudi Co-operative Town Bank Ltd., Tamil Nadu. The bank was found to have sanctioned loans in breach of SAF directions on exposure limits and collateral requirements.

Impact

The bank must absorb the monetary penalty and may still face any other action RBI chooses to initiate separately. The release does not indicate a direct operational restriction on customers, but it underscores stricter compliance expectations around lending limits and collateralization.

Why RBI acted

Lending normsGovernance oversight

Regulatory basis

  • Section 47A(1)(c) read with Sections 46(4)(i) and 56 of the Banking Regulation Act, 1949
